As part of a major construction project (over $500M), we are seeking a Project Communications Advisor to lead the internal and external communications strategy in collaboration with the project’s stakeholders (client, EPC partners, communities, internal teams, Indigenous groups). The advisor writes articles, video scripts, and notices to residents, and manages relationships with the media, local communities, Indigenous Peoples, and authorities. They support the client in promoting the project and managing communication challenges with stakeholders. This role is essential to ensure transparency, consistency, and impact of messaging throughout the project lifecycle.
